Transfer in tunnel dream: what does it mean?

Transfer in tunnel dreams add a specific twist to the usual layover dream: instead of waiting in an open, visible space, you're changing course somewhere enclosed, dim, and underground.

Dreaming of „layover” with a detail

A plain layover dream is about pause and waiting, usually in a place you can see clearly, like a terminal or lobby. A transfer in a tunnel changes that. You're not just waiting between flights or trains; you're actively moving from one path to another while surrounded by walls, low light, and no clear view of what's ahead or behind.

This often shows up when you're in the middle of a real-life shift, a job change, a move, a decision, but you can't yet see the whole picture. The tunnel adds a sense of being boxed in or rushed, like you have to make this transfer correctly even though you can't fully assess your surroundings. It's less about the wait and more about trusting your footing mid-change.

Good signs

This dream can mean you're capable of navigating unclear situations without needing every detail mapped out first. It may reflect confidence that you can find your way through a transition, even one that feels closed-in or uncertain, and still land where you need to be.

What to watch for

If the tunnel felt cramped, rushed, or maze-like, it may reflect real anxiety about a decision you're making with limited information. It's worth noticing if you feel pressured to choose a direction in waking life before you feel ready or fully informed.

Frequently asked questions

What does it mean to dream about transferring in a tunnel specifically?

It usually points to a transition you're making without full clarity, like a decision or change happening while key details are still hidden. The tunnel adds pressure and enclosure that a normal layover dream doesn't have.

Is a tunnel transfer dream a bad sign?

Not at all. It's a common reflection of navigating uncertainty, not a warning. Many people have this dream during ordinary life changes, like switching jobs or making a big choice, when the outcome isn't fully visible yet.

Why does the dream feel more stressful than a normal layover dream?

Tunnels naturally feel enclosed and dim, which can heighten anxiety in a dream. That intensity usually mirrors real feelings of being boxed in by a decision, not an actual danger or bad omen.
